# Zedd

> Zedd, born Anton Zaslavski, is a German record producer, DJ and songwriter whose precise, melody-first electronic pop grew from childhood piano lessons, metal-band drumming and an early fascination with Justice. After the Grammy-winning breakthrough of “Clarity” and crossover hits including “Stay” and “The Middle,” he took nine years between studio albums and returned with Telos, an orchestral, personal record that reconnects festival-scale production to Bach, Muse, Jeff Buckley and the instincts that made him a musician before he became a brand.

## Career timeline

- **1989** — Born Anton Zaslavski in Saratov, then part of the Soviet Union.
- **1992** — Moved with his family to the Kaiserslautern area in Germany, where he grew up.
- **1993** — Began playing piano at age four.
- **2002** — Joined the German metalcore band Dioramic as its drummer at age twelve.
- **2009** — Began producing electronic music after hearing Justice’s album Cross.
- **2010** — Won two Beatport remix contests and remixed Skrillex’s “Scary Monsters and Nice Sprites.”
- **2012** — Released debut album Clarity; its title track later reached No. 8 on the Billboard Hot 100.
- **2014** — Won the Grammy Award for Best Dance Recording for “Clarity” with Foxes.
- **2015** — Released second studio album True Colors.
- **2017** — Released “Stay” with Alessia Cara, a Billboard Hot 100 top-ten single.
- **2018** — Released “The Middle” with Maren Morris and Grey; it reached No. 5 on the Hot 100.
- **2024** — Released Telos, his first studio album in nine years, and began the Telos Tour.
- **2025** — Telos received a Grammy nomination for Best Dance/Electronic Album; he also co-created music for Dragon Ball Daima.
- **2026** — Expanded Zedd in the Park to New York for its fifth edition.

## Achievements

- Won the 2014 Grammy Award for Best Dance Recording for “Clarity” featuring Foxes.
- Earned six Grammy nominations through the 2025 awards, including three for “The Middle” and one for Telos.
- Reached the Billboard Hot 100 top ten with “Clarity,” “Stay,” “The Middle” and Ariana Grande’s “Break Free.”
- Won the 2016 Billboard Music Award for Top Dance/Electronic Album for True Colors.
- Won MTV Video Music Awards for “Stay the Night” in 2014 and “Stay” in 2017.
- Co-created the opening and ending themes for the anime series Dragon Ball Daima.
